    Quick answer

    Werum PAS-X is a pharmaceutical-grade Manufacturing Execution System (MES) used by many of the world's largest drug manufacturers, focused on electronic batch records, weigh-and-dispense and shop-floor execution under GMP. Worldover is an AI operating system built specifically for chemical and cosmetic companies; it covers the end-to-end regulated operation (formulation, PIF, CPSR, MoCRA, REACH, CLP, PCN, SDS, batch, customer documentation) with AI agents that draft, file and monitor on live data, on a faster and lighter platform than a pharma MES.

    Where Werum PAS-X fits

    Werum PAS-X is the right tool where pharma-grade MES is the requirement: regulated drug or biologic manufacturing under FDA / EMA GMP, where 21 CFR Part 11, electronic batch records, weigh-and-dispense and line clearance are non-negotiable and the scale justifies the implementation effort.
